Question

After the brakes are engaged, the distance traveled by bus in t seconds equals 1+2t-2t2 meters. The bus travels a distance equivalent to before stopping is


A

0.5m

Solution

The correct option is C

1.5m


Step: 1 Given data

Traveled distance is s=1+2t-2t21

Step: 2 Formula used

The relation between velocity and displacement is,

v=dsdt, where v=velocity, s=displacement, and t=time.

Step: 3 Calculate the time when the bus stop moving:

To obtain the velocity, differentiate the equation 1.

dsdt=0+2-4tv=2-4t

For the time when the bus stops moving, velocity =0

2-4t=0-4t=-2t=12s

Step: 4 Calculate the distance travelled by the bus before stopping:

So, the distance traveled in 12s is,

s=1+2t-2t2s=1+212-2122s=32s=1.5

Hence, option C is correct.
